The Science Museum in London is a highly regarded institution that offers an extensive collection of scientific, technological, and medical achievements. Visitors consistently praise the museum's interactive exhibits, which cater to both children and adults, making science accessible and engaging for all ages. The space gallery, featuring real rockets and space-related artifacts, is often cited as a highlight. Many reviewers appreciate the museum's free entry, although some note that special exhibitions may require a fee. The hands-on experiences and demonstrations are particularly popular, allowing visitors to participate in scientific experiments and learn through doing. The museum's layout is generally well-organized, guiding visitors through different scientific eras and fields. However, some visitors mention that it can get crowded, especially during peak times and school holidays, which may impact the overall experience. A few reviewers note that some exhibits could benefit from updates or maintenance. The museum's café and gift shop receive mixed reviews, with some finding them overpriced. Overall, the Science Museum is widely recommended for its educational value, impressive collections, and ability to spark curiosity about science and technology in visitors of all ages.
